PWV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2017 in Review

99 of the 4,034 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Invesco Large Cap Value ETF (PWV) for Q1 2017, worth a combined $588M — up 12% from $524M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 15 funds opened new PWV positions and 6 closed out — a net gain of 9 holders — while 24 added to existing stakes and 35 trimmed.

The largest buyer was PNC Financial Services Group, adding an estimated $23.5M. The largest seller was Bank of America, cutting an estimated $4.65M.
